It was also the case for Reeaz Khan, an illegal alien from Guyana, who raped and murdered a 92-year-old(!) Queens woman last week.

Khan was a beneficiary not only of New York’s sanctuary status but of the city’s new “bail reform” law, which effectively turns wrongdoers lose onto the street with the hope they’ll show up for their arraignment.

In Khan’s case, the bail reform law kicked in last November when he got into a scrape with his father. Via the New York Post, Khan was accused of using a broken ceramic mug to slash the chest and arm of his 42-year-old dad, who required hospitalization. He was charged with misdemeanor assault, criminal possession of a weapon and harassment. He was then released without bail.

Around this time, U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) issued a detainer request with the New York Police Department for Khan, but it was ignored because of New York’s sanctuary status.

Now thanks to both policies, 92-year-old Maria Fuertes, Khan’s most recent victim, is dead.

Another beneficiary of this new liberal brand of justice is Jordan Randolph, a 40-year-old man with a lengthy criminal rap sheet. Randolph, Randolph, who has a history of drunk driving, was arrested and released without bail on January 1. Eleven days later, he killed 27-year-old Jonathan Armand Flores-Maldonado in another DUI incident.
